网络流量统计软件如何识别流量异常?
在当今信息化时代,网络已经成为人们生活、工作的重要组成部分。然而,随着网络流量的不断增长,如何有效识别和应对流量异常,成为网络安全领域的重要课题。本文将深入探讨网络流量统计软件如何识别流量异常,帮助企业和个人提高网络安全防护能力。
一、什么是网络流量异常?
网络流量异常是指在网络通信过程中,出现与正常流量规律不符的流量变化。这种异常可能由多种原因引起,如恶意攻击、内部故障、人为误操作等。网络流量异常的识别对于保障网络安全具有重要意义。
二、网络流量统计软件的作用
网络流量统计软件能够实时监测网络流量,分析流量数据,帮助用户识别流量异常。以下是网络流量统计软件的主要作用:
实时监控网络流量:网络流量统计软件可以实时监控网络流量,包括入站流量、出站流量等,以便及时发现异常情况。
分析流量数据:通过对流量数据的分析,网络流量统计软件可以发现流量异常的规律和特点,为后续处理提供依据。
识别恶意攻击:网络流量统计软件可以识别恶意攻击,如DDoS攻击、SQL注入等,及时采取措施阻止攻击。
优化网络资源:通过分析流量数据,网络流量统计软件可以帮助用户优化网络资源,提高网络性能。
三、网络流量统计软件如何识别流量异常?
- 基于流量特征的识别
网络流量统计软件通过分析流量特征,如数据包大小、传输速率、协议类型等,识别流量异常。以下是一些常见的流量特征:
- 数据包大小异常:与正常流量相比,数据包大小突然增大或减小,可能是恶意攻击或内部故障。
- 传输速率异常:传输速率突然上升或下降,可能是恶意攻击或网络故障。
- 协议类型异常:异常的协议类型可能表明恶意攻击或非法访问。
- 基于流量行为的识别
网络流量统计软件通过分析流量行为,如数据包发送频率、连接持续时间等,识别流量异常。以下是一些常见的流量行为:
- 连接持续时间异常:连接持续时间过长或过短,可能是恶意攻击或异常访问。
- 数据包发送频率异常:数据包发送频率过高或过低,可能是恶意攻击或异常访问。
- 基于机器学习的识别
网络流量统计软件可以利用机器学习算法,根据历史流量数据建立正常流量模型,然后对实时流量数据进行异常检测。以下是一些常见的机器学习算法:
- 聚类算法:将流量数据划分为不同的簇,识别异常簇。
- 分类算法:将流量数据分为正常流量和异常流量,识别异常流量。
四、案例分析
以下是一个基于实际案例的网络流量异常识别分析:
某企业网络出现异常,网络流量统计软件发现以下情况:
- 数据包大小异常:部分数据包大小远大于正常流量。
- 传输速率异常:传输速率突然上升,持续一段时间后恢复正常。
- 协议类型异常:异常的协议类型为HTTP。
根据以上分析,网络流量统计软件判断这可能是一次针对该企业的恶意攻击。进一步调查发现,攻击者利用该企业服务器发起DDoS攻击,导致企业网络瘫痪。
五、总结
网络流量统计软件在识别流量异常方面发挥着重要作用。通过分析流量特征、流量行为和机器学习算法,网络流量统计软件可以及时发现和应对流量异常,保障网络安全。企业和个人应重视网络流量统计软件的应用,提高网络安全防护能力。
猜你喜欢:云原生NPM